[00:05:43] Popular Car Event Donates Over $3-million to Charity
In the beginning, Bill Warner, Founder of the Amelia Island Concours d’Elegance, was asked to create an event that would bring business to the island. Bill agreed with one very strict stipulation; the money they raised at the event would go to charity, and with that a foundation was born. To date over $3-million has been raised to benefit amazing causes like Spina Bifida of Jacksonville, community hospice, Navy-Marine Corps Relief Society, and the Fernandina Beach Shop with Cops program for underprivileged children. [00:19:33] Shell Eco-Marathon Inspires Fuel-Saving Innovations
Celebrating its 10th Anniversary, the Shell Eco-Marathon America is putting the future of fuel economy into the hands of a younger generation at the Make the Future Detroit festival. Pam Rosen, General Manager of the Shell Eco-Marathon North America, shares how students from all over the country are spending months designing fuel efficient vehicles to be tested on a specially created track in downtown Detroit. Some teams have achieved well over 1,000 miles per gallon! With a 5k fun run, Q&A’s with notable NASCAR drivers, and hands-on activities galore, this free festival is a home run for the whole family. [00:35:34] The Luxurious Jeep Grand Cherokee SRT
Don’t let the popular misconception fool you, a car can be both masculine AND luxurious. Chris Duke, Host of Motorz, describes the supple black suede interior of the new Jeep Grand Cherokee SRT, assuring us that his masculinity remained intact due to the sheer power of the vehicle. This glorious ride comes equipped with a 6.4L Hemi V8 and is engineered for high performance on and off the track. [00:41:48] Hennessey Performance Revamps Epic 2017 Ford Raptor
The 2017 Ford Raptor is the “Swiss Army Knife of vehicles”, as John Hennessey puts it. This truck can do everything you need it to do; hauling, towing, every-day driving, and even dirt racing. As if all of that was not enough, Hennessey Performance has created the VelociRaptor 600 Supercharged Engine Upgrade, effectively making the Raptor taller, faster, and wider – Oh my! Did we mention that with Hennessey’s skilled tuning, the 2017 V6 10-speed cranked out more power than the 6.2L V8 on the dyno? [00:48:04] Horsepower 101: Aftermarket Mods for Camaro ZL1
Nobody knows horsepower like John Hennessey of Hennessey Performance. John shares his experience with the stock Camaro ZL1 and its surprising speed battle against the Corvette Z06. The Camaro’s supercharged V8 has powerful torque while remaining light and nimble. We also hear about The Hennessey Tuner School which teaches students to modify wheels, tires, suspension, and tuning in addition to hands-on welding and fabrication techniques, and a powerful knowledge of superchargers and turbochargers. [00:53:57] BJ Killeen Buys Lincoln MKC SUV, Enjoys Luxury Perks
It was finally time for automotive journalist BJ Killen to buy a car and she had a craving for luxury. BJ was immediately drawn to the compact Lincoln MKC SUV because of Lincoln’s unique “pickup and delivery ownership experience.” The convenient service allows you to contact a local dealership via smartphone app, have your vehicle picked up, serviced, washed and dropped off at your destination of choice – in the meantime, owners enjoy a complimentary loner vehicle. [01:01:13] Hyundai Ioniq’s Modular Drivetrain Platform
For the first time, Hyundai has created a modular electric drivetrain platform, and it’s flippin’ brilliant! Kelley Blue Book’s Karl Brauer explains that the Hyundai Ioniq has three different engine options; hybrid, plug-in hybrid, and pure EV. These cars have a sufficient driving range of 124 miles, 136 MPGe efficiency, and a price tag as low as $19,000 after state and federal rebates. Built-in navigation helps drivers find the nearest charging station to help eliminate any ‘range anxiety’. Plus, the Ioniq is small, yet spacious with the most interior volume of any hybrid on the market. Karl shares release dates and more.

[01:17:14] Boutique LA Garage, Workshop 5001, Restores Classics
Jerry Seinfeld and Bill Gates may have started the trend, but there is no doubt about it, the vintage Porsche is taking the collector car world by storm. Porsche enthusiasts are spending hundreds of thousands of dollars on these exquisite machines and they’re looking for skilled craftsmen to work on them. Workshop 5001, along with a global network of specialty vendors and fabricators, is delivering the finest finished builds in the marketplace.
